Flow Cytometry analysis of U937 cells using anti-SLC2A9 antibody. Overlay histogram showing U937 cells (Blue line). To facilitate intracellular staining, cells were fixed with 4% paraformaldehyde and permeabilized with permeabilization buffer. The cells were blocked with 10% normal goat serum. And then incubated with rabbit anti-SLC2A9 Antibody (1 µg/1x10 6 cells) for 30 min at 20C. DyLight488 conjugated goat anti-rabbit IgG (5-10 µg/1x10 6 cells) was used as secondary antibody for 30 minutes at 20C. Isotype control antibody (Green line) was rabbit IgG (1 µg/1x10 6) used under the same conditions. Unlabelled sample without incubation with primary antibody and secondary antibody (Red line) was used as a blank control.
IF analysis of SLC2A9 using anti-SLC2A9 antibody. SLC2A9 was detected in immunocytochemical section of A549 cells. Enzyme antigen retrieval was performed using IHC enzyme antigen retrieval reagent for 15 mins. The cells were blocked with 10% goat serum. And then incubated with 2 µg/mL rabbit anti-SLC2A9 Antibody overnight at 4C. DyLight488 conjugated Goat Anti-Rabbit IgG was used as secondary antibody at 1:100 dilution and incubated for 30 minutes at 37C. The section was counterstained with DAPI. Visualize using a fluorescence microscope and filter sets appropriate for the label used.
IHC analysis of SLC2A9 using anti-SLC2A9 antibody. SLC2A9 was detected in paraffin-embedded section of human prostatic cancer tissue. Heat mediated antigen retrieval was performed in EDTA buffer (pH8.0, epitope retrieval solution). The tissue section was blocked with 10% goat serum. The tissue section was then incubated with 1 µg/ml rabbit anti-SLC2A9 Antibody overnight at 4C. Biotinylated goat anti-rabbit IgG was used as secondary antibody and incubated for 30 minutes at 37C. The tissue section was developed using Strepavidin-Biotin-Complex (SABC) with DAB as the chromogen.
